best django rich text editorstechcol gracie bone china plates
- Posted by
- on Jul, 17, 2022
- in avocado digestion time
- Blog Comments Off on best django rich text editor
This lifts the security and practicality highlight of the Bootstrap rich text editor. .. TinyMCE rich text editor. WYSIWYG Rich Text Editor. Built to scale. # settings.py INSTALLED_APPS = ['django.contrib.admin', 'django_quill',] Making Model. Step 1. A comparison of the 7 Best Material UI WYSIWYG Editor Libraries in 2022: material-ui-editor, mui-quill, react-rte-material, material-ui-rte, material-ui-html-field and more Draft-js-wysiwyg is a rich text editor built using React , Draft and Material-UI libraries. Slate.js Free Editor with Complex Content Support. from .models import GeeksModel. First one is to do the following: * Visit Django Packages : WYSIWYG Editors. Thus, a geeks_field RichTextField is created when you run migrations on the project. Here are 5 things to look for in the best rich text editors. this tutorial will cover integration of froala text editor in django, I believe you already have the basics of django for this will cover more advanced topic and so, if you have not you can see my django introduction tutorial to learn before moving to this kind of tutorials. 2. Now run, python manage.py migrate. admin.site.register (GeeksModel) Edit your models.py file accordingly and introduce an HTMLField () for Rich Text Editor:] from django.db import models from tinymce.models import HTMLField class MyModel (models.Model): content = HTMLField () This will integrate a simple Rich Text Editor in your django application. Do some basic settings like including urls of app. Demo Download. In order to use the features of "ck editor", we first must need to install it. A CMS framework for Django built on a heterogenous tree editor. Add tinymce to INSTALLED_APPS in settings.py for your project: INSTALLED_APPS = ( 'tinymce', ) Trix 16,810. INSTALLED_APPS = [ 'myapp.apps.MyappConfig', #django app ' django_quill' #module name] . 1. The final rich-text editor in this list is Summernote, which is both super simple to install, and lightweight. By replicating bits of reusable code, django-chunks ensures that pieces of the layout can quickly and easily be changed if need be. In our project, we are going to use CKEditor. Categories > Text Editors > Rich Text Editor. WYSIWYG editor based on CKEditor with completely rewritten UI. This page is powered by a knowledgeable community that helps you make an informed decision. django-richtext lets you easily have a rich text editor for any of your django model fields or form fields. Microsoft visual studio codeSublime text editorBracketsAtomNotepad++ TinyMCE The most advanced WYSIWYG HTML editor designed to simplify website content creation. Its a huge step ahead of the initial Vi, with more powerful features. Jodit React. Step 3. Step 1. Vue2Editor. Although Slate.js is still in beta, it has more than 20K GitHub stars. It comes with syntax highlighting, debugger support for both python 2 and python 3, Git integration, web development frameworks like Django and Flask. Compatibility: Windows, Linux, Mac OS, IOS, Android, UNIX, AmigaOS, and MorphOS. In my opinion, that is not a wise decision. Welcome to my other tutorial in django. Also, setting to empower or handicap read just mode permits job-based access to content. 1. Like if you are developing a web application and using Django ,flask or any other python based framework then Pycharm is the best editor. 14. Top 15: Best Rich Text Editor Components (WYSIWYG) for ReactJSTinyMCE React. TinyMCE is a platform independent web based Javascript HTML WYSIWYG editor control released as Open Source under LGPL.CKEditor React. Modern JavaScript rich text editor with a modular architecture. Draft.js. React RTE. React Prosemirror. React Draft WYSIWYG. React Page. Dante2. React Quill. React Summernote. More items Install Django and create a django project and app. Share. An easy-to-use but yet powerful and customizable rich text editor powered by Quill.js and Vue.js. Supports global editor settings, reusable editor profiles and per field & widget settings. 10. Theres built-in support for pluggable server side content sanitizers. Trusted open source rich text editor for devs who want control. App containing models.py must be added to INSTALLED_APPS; After adding the app, you need to run makemigrations and migrate to create the DB table. . [UNDER DEVELOPMENT] With this project I'm building a fully functioning collaborative rich text editor using Python, Django and React, which I'll eventually deploy it into the real world! Download link. Demo/Code. In this top, we will share with you the best 15 rich text editor components for React.js. * Find the editor you like * Integrate it using instructions * Benefit Second approach would be downloading, or even writing a Wysiwyg editor yourself. CKEditor, Bootstrap wysihtml5, and TinyMCE are probably your best bets out of the 7 options considered. Here is a list of 7 best, top-rated WYSIWYG rich text editors from which you can choose in the next web & mobile app. django-richtextRich Text Editors can be painful to install and configure, even with the powerful Django Framework. So without much further ado, lets check out the following rich text editors. Throwing a rich text editor control on top of it make it even easier. 2. Add QuillField to the Model class you want to use. Quill is a modern WYSIWYG editor built for compatibility and extensibility. Support for coloring text or background. If you only expect JPG and PNG for example, this is easy. Hence, a higher number means a Install django-tinymce: $ pip install django-tinymce. Combined Topics. It provides lots of features: Configurable toolbar with option to add/remove controls. Python3. Follow. Awesome Open Source. Create a media folder at the same level of project and app. Support for block types: Paragraph, H1 H6, Blockquote, Code. MIT. Froala Editor comes with the plugins: block style, text & background colors, font size, font family, insert video, insert table, media manager, lists and file upload. python manage.py makemigrations python manage.py migrate python manage.py collectstatic. Install this package. from django.contrib import admin. Quill your powerful rich text editor.. Granular access to the editors content, changes and events through a simple 2. 1. TinyMCE is a WYSIWYG HTML editor, which means it allows users to write HTML content without having to actually write any HTML code. 1. Quill.JS Quill is a free , open source WYSIWYG powerful rich text editor built for the modern web. Download now. Sublime is also one of the best text editor for both general and development purposes. . Browse The Most Popular 3 Django Rich Text Editor Open Source Projects. Option to change the order of the controls in the toolbar. django x. rich-text-editor x. It is a modal editor that splits file viewing from file editing. Go to admin.py and register your model. Topics react python redis django django-rest-framework sqlite3 django-channels javscript draftjs Ran Django template. You'd Answer: There are 2 routes. Initally, I was drawn towards CKEditor, however it turns out that it is best suited for admin page. Best free WYSIWYG editor Python Django admin panel integration 1. For the sake of simplicity, I have presented the steps with lucrative code examples. Step 5 . I am building a notemaker application with Django and I want suggestion for a Rich text Editor that all my users can use. Vim is amongst the top 5 in our list of the best text editors for Python. Django admin CKEditor integration. Features: Open-Source Supports all modern browsers on desktops, tablets and phones. You can resize an image 1:1, and it will fail on broken images, removing much of the XSS vectors and RCE vectors. In this tutorial we will implement tinymce text editor in our django application. TinyMCE. A step by step guide as to how to convert EXACTLY 1 field to Rich text field, or another simple Rich Text Editor that I can use with django-crispy-forms would be very helpful. Jodit is an excellent Open Source WYSIWYG editor written in pure TypeScript without using additional libraries. Demo. Awesome Open Source. Summernote is open-source software, completely customisable, and can be integrated with various back-end frameworks. Originally published Nov 06 2019, updated Mar 06 2022. Provides a RichTextField, RichTextUploadingField, CKEditorWidget and CKEditorUploadingWidget utilizing CKEditor with image uploading and browsing support included. Tables are difficult to use within normal WYSIWYG rich-text editors. Quill 33,042. Share On Twitter. finally restart your Django server. A django app that allows the easy addition of Stack Overflow's "PageDown" markdown editor to a django form field, whethe Package to integrate Froala WYSIWYG HTML rich text editor with Django. Tested with TinyMCE and CKEditor. Designed to be easily django-quill-editor makes Quill.js easy to use on Django A rich text editor for everyday writing. After integrating Django CKEditor we will have a Rich Text Editor with image uploading capability instead if boring